Objective

Students recognize how the professional practice of Bachelors of Social Services is connected with issues in society and ethics. Students know how to make use of current themes in society to examine their professional growth. They acknowledge the role of reflection skills as a tool in professional growth and are able to describe their strengths and development needs with help of professional competence descriptions for Bachelors of Social Services.

Content

-Theoretical background of the professional growth process
-Competences for Bachelors of Social Services
-Current topics in the social work field
